Output 84a34fed01aca29d5adaaae13914b4bb73006abde45891e922154ca806ee9d07:0

value
590700
script pubkey
OP_0 OP_PUSHBYTES_20 6b666e2e082ebc95e55ed6f05bbb3f12b259518d
address
bc1qddnxutsg967fte276mc9hwelz2e9j5vd2504p7
transaction
84a34fed01aca29d5adaaae13914b4bb73006abde45891e922154ca806ee9d07
spent
true